No, currently there isn't a way to use the same long code in multiple accounts or Subaccounts.
You can create a separate long code for each Subaccount by logging in to that account and heading to Settings > SMS > Create Long code.
If you have any other questions, feel free to reach out to our Support Team. We'd love to help!